Arrogant, charismatic, and untouchable—what more could you possibly ask for from a villain? Zil was the epitome of a final boss, reigning supreme throughout part one of the anime Ragnarök: Twilight of the Gods. However, in a cruel yet hackneyed twist, he was reduced to fodder and insta-killed to make way for the next big baddie's grand entrance. It's far from the type of fictional character you'd want to randomly wake up as, but that's the sad reality our protagonist finds himself in after falling asleep in front of his TV. Not one to throw in the towel so easily, he swears to defy his fate even if it means facing the gods! But breaking canon is easier said than done. First, he must build up his strength and his forces while perfectly maintaining Zil's imposing facade and . Uh, hang on. Why is everyone suddenly worshipping him as a god? Oh well, as long as it boosts his chances of survival! (Source: J-Novel Club)
